Societal Factors
How can our communities make the healthy choice the easy choice?

In our fast paced, time-crunched world, societal and institutional roadblocks often hinder people from eating smart and being active. This group will connect people to discuss what these roadblocks are and how we can move past them to make the healthy choice an easier choice in our communities.
This group is moderated by Joel Spoonheim, a leader in community change who has worked for city governments, a food manufacturer, and non-profits as a leader of major initiatives that require engaging diverse stakeholders and complex problem solving. In 2009, he led the AARP Blue Zones Vitality Project in Albert Lea, Minnesota which engaged thousands of citizens in improving the health of the community.
